About this listen
In which it seems Ginger Baldy’s been transported back to 1967 and He-Feels-He’s-Fixing-To-Die all over again.
1. I Got My Mojo Working - Joyce Harris & The Daylighters
2. My Good Pott - Doc Pomus
3. Lonely Avenue - Taj Mahal
4. Because The Night - Patti Smith Group
5. I’m On Fire - Soccer Mommy
6. Gonna Make It Alone - The Bellfuries
7. Tell Her No - The Zombies
8. Night Life - Roy Orbison
9. Night Life - B.B. King & His Orchestra
10. Me And Paul - Doug Sahm & Band
11. I-Feel-Like-I’m-Fixing-To-Die Rag - Country Joe & The Fish (This month’s combined earworm & death song)
12. Kiss My Ass - Country Joe & The Fish
13. Something's Got A Hold On Me - Etta James
14. The Wallflower (Roll With Me Henry) - Richard Berry with Etta James & The Peaches.
15. Sixty Minute Man - Billy Ward & The Dominoes
Theme song: Small Town Talk - Bobby Charles (1973)
